Creating an ESL lesson plan can be a challenging task, especially when trying to cater to the diverse needs of adult learners. A well-structured lesson plan is essential for ensuring that the class runs smoothly and that students achieve their learning objectives. A typical English lesson plan might include sections such as objectives, materials needed, a detailed breakdown of activities, and assessment methods. Objectives outline what the students should be able to do by the end of the lesson, while the materials section lists all the resources required for the class. The activities section provides a step-by-step guide to the lesson, detailing each activity, its purpose, and the expected duration. Finally, the assessment methods help teachers evaluate whether the learning objectives have been met. When designing an English lesson, it's important to choose topics that are relevant and interesting to the students. Popular English lesson topics for adults might include business English, travel, technology, health, and current events. These topics not only provide useful vocabulary and language structures but also encourage students to engage in meaningful conversations and discussions. For instance, a lesson on business English might cover topics such as writing emails, participating in meetings, and negotiating deals, while a lesson on travel could include vocabulary related to booking flights, navigating airports, and discussing travel experiences. ESL lessons for adults often need to be tailored to the specific needs and interests of the students. Adult learners typically have different motivations for learning English compared to younger students, and these motivations should be taken into account when planning lessons. Some adults might be learning English for professional reasons, such as advancing their careers or improving their job prospects, while others might be learning for personal reasons, such as traveling or communicating with friends and family. Understanding these motivations can help teachers design lessons that are both relevant and motivating for their students.
